Werder Bremen Clarifies Boniface Injury Status

Werder Bremen has publicly denied recent reports suggesting that striker Victor Boniface will undergo season-ending surgery. The German club clarified that Boniface is currently in Innsbruck, Austria, and is scheduled to see a specialist on January 8th.
While the need for surgery has been dismissed, it remains unlikely that Boniface will feature for Werder Bremen in the near future. His ongoing fitness issues and past disciplinary matters make a return to the squad improbable.
This situation has prompted Werder Bremen to intensify their search for attacking reinforcements during the current January transfer window, especially given Boniface's failure to score any goals during his loan spell. The club is also considering offers for young forward Keke Topp.
